Does it mean that you
insert into forecast select * from budget;
insert into forecast select * from sales;
Then, you created a form which is based on the FORECAST table. You also set "Org.Code" item's ENABLED property to "No". As far as I'm concerned, that item is disabled for all records in the FORECAST table, regardless their origin. Unless, of course, you used SET_ITEM_PROPERTY and did some modifications; however, as you didn't mention that, I suppose you didn't do it).
